Poverty remains a pervasive global issue, affecting millions and manifesting through inadequate access to basic needs such as food, clean water, and shelter. It stems from complex factors, including economic disparity, lack of education, and systemic inequality. Individuals living in poverty often face barriers to healthcare, education, and employment, perpetuating a cycle of disadvantage. Addressing poverty requires a multifaceted approach: improving education, creating job opportunities, and enhancing social safety nets. Governments, organizations, and communities must work collaboratively to implement effective policies and provide support services. Additionally, fostering economic growth, investing in infrastructure, and promoting fair trade can help uplift marginalized populations. By tackling these root causes and working towards more equitable systems, we can make significant strides in reducing poverty and improving the quality of life for millions.
